Black Joe Lewis and The Honeybears is a renowned band known for their electrifying blend of blues, rock, and funk. With a career that has spanned over a decade, they have captivated audiences with their high-energy performances and soulful sound. The band is led by the charismatic frontman Black Joe Lewis, whose powerful vocals and dynamic guitar skills have earned them a dedicated following. They will be performing at One Longfellow Square in Portland, Maine on July 12, 2026, as part of their latest tour.
Their discography includes popular albums such as "Tell 'Em What Your Name Is!" and "Electric Slave," featuring hit songs that showcase their unique style.
